Job Title: Temporary HR Consultant

Location: Melbourne CBD

Organization: Large government body within the public sector, that thrives on early childhood education.

**Responsibilities**:

- Assist with the recruitment process for multiple open positions within the organization
- Develop and implement effective sourcing strategies to attract top talent
- Screen and evaluate job applicants to determine their suitability for the role
- Collaborate with hiring managers to identify their recruitment needs and develop job descriptions
- Provide guidance and support to hiring managers throughout the selection process
- Stay up to date with current HR and recruitment trends to bring new ideas and best practices to the organization

**Requirements**:

-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ources or a related field
- Experience in recruitment and HR
- Strong understanding of HR laws and regulations
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work well under pressure and meet tight deadlines
- Excellent organizational and time management skills
- Proficiency in HR software and recruitment tools
